Hi all,

 

Will windows / the ATI CCC allow me to extend my desktop onto one or two extra monitors in addition to my eyefinity monitors?

 

Also, since I only have 5 video connectors on the back of my primary XFX 6950 and I want to connect up to 6 monitors, can I connect the sixth monitor to my second crossfired 6950? If I cannot, do you have a suggestion of how I should connect the sixth monitor?

 

Thanks for the help.

 

Yes you can run additional monitors to an eyefinity setup (I have an additional 23 inch touchscreen running of a seperate video card) and windows will recognise them, DCS will only output to them when run in windows mode (ie: NOT fullscreen)

I don't have the 6950 but I've been looking at them and the 6970 and although you have 5 connectors the native support from one of those cards only supports output to 4 Monitors. The HDMI connection is shared internally with one of the DVI connections. (incidentally when running Crossfire you do not get any output out of the second card, as far as I'm aware.)

And whilst, you will eventually be able to run 6 Screen eyefinity, you need a DisplayPort 1.2 Multi-Stream Transport converter, which are not yet available or a display port 1.2 enabled monitor to daisy chain the output.

 

Good explanation here and a bit more technical here

Hope this helps but sorry if I've shattered a 6 screen hope (for now anyway)
